excel文本为什么不能换行
作者:路由通
|
186人看过
发布时间:2025-11-30 19:12:44
标签:
本文深入解析电子表格软件中文本无法自动换行的十二个关键原因,涵盖单元格格式设置、特殊字符影响、数据导入兼容性及编程接口限制等维度。通过真实案例演示解决方案,帮助用户从根本上掌握文本换行的核心技术要点,提升数据处理效率。
在使用电子表格软件进行数据处理时,许多用户都遭遇过文本内容无法按预期换行显示的困扰。这种现象背后涉及软件设计原理、数据存储机制和操作逻辑等多重因素。下面通过系统化分析,揭示文本换行失效的根本原因及应对策略。单元格格式限制导致的换行失效 当单元格被设置为"文本"格式时,软件会将所有输入内容识别为纯文本字符串,包括换行符(ASCII码10)。但由于文本格式的设计初衷是保持数据完整性,系统会自动过滤掉这些控制字符。例如在输入"第一行[Alt+Enter]第二行"时,若单元格预先设置为文本格式,换行符将被忽略而显示为连续文本。 另一个典型场景是导入外部数据时,系统默认以文本格式存储内容。某用户从企业资源计划系统导出带换行符的地址数据,在电子表格中打开后所有换行符失效,正是因为导入时未正确识别换行控制字符。自动换行功能未启用的影响 即使单元格中存在软换行符(通过Alt+Enter手动插入),若未启用"自动换行"选项,文本仍然会显示为单行。这是因为自动换行功能实际上包含两个独立机制:一是对显式换行符的解析,二是根据列宽自动折行显示。 某财务人员在制作资金使用说明表时,虽然正确使用了Alt+Enter添加换行符,但因忘记启用自动换行选项,导致打印时所有文本挤在同一行。这个问题通过右键单元格→设置单元格格式→对齐→勾选"自动换行"即可解决。行高固定导致的显示问题 当用户手动设置行高为固定值时,系统会严格限制行高显示范围。即使文本已正确换行,若行高不足则只能显示部分内容。这种情况常见于从模板复制的数据,其中预设的行高无法适应实际文本量。 某行政人员制作员工信息表时,发现备注栏的文字虽显示换行符但内容被截断。通过选择整行→右键→行高→选择"自动调整行高"后,所有内容才完整显现。实测显示,当行高固定为12.75磅时,最多只能显示一行标准字体文本。特殊字符的干扰现象 非打印字符如制表符(ASCII码9)或垂直制表符(ASCII码11)会干扰换行符的正常解析。这些字符常出现在从网页或文档复制的内容中,导致换行功能异常。 某市场人员从网页复制产品说明到电子表格时,虽然源文本显示正常换行,但粘贴后所有文本连成一片。使用CLEAN函数清理非打印字符后,换行功能立即恢复正常。经测试,包含3个以上连续制表符的文本串会使换行解析完全失效。字体兼容性问题 某些特殊字体(如等宽字体或符号字体)不支持标准换行符解析。当单元格应用这些字体时,即使用户正确使用换行操作,文本仍会保持单行显示。 某设计人员使用符号字体制作技术文档时,发现所有换行操作无效。将字体改为系统标准字体(如宋体或微软雅黑)后,换行立即恢复正常。值得注意的是,某些第三方字体甚至会将换行符渲染为可见符号而非执行换行指令。公式输出结果的限制 使用CONCATENATE或TEXTJOIN等函数合并文本时,若未显式添加换行符(CHAR(10)),即使源数据包含换行符,输出结果也会丢失换行格式。这是因为公式运算时会自动规范化文本格式。 某分析师合并多个单元格的地址信息时,使用公式"=A2&B2&C2"后所有换行符消失。改为"=A2&CHAR(10)&B2&CHAR(10)&C2"并结合自动换行功能后,才实现正确分行显示。实验证明,公式中每添加一个CHAR(10)需要对应启用自动换行才能生效。数据导入过程中的解析错误 从CSV或TXT文件导入数据时,若未在导入向导中正确指定文本限定符和分隔符,换行符可能被错误解析为记录分隔符而非文本控制符。根据RFC4180标准,CS文件中的换行符必须包含在文本限定符内才被视为内容部分。 某工程师导入传感器日志数据时,由于未在导入向导中选择"文本识别符"选项,导致原本应该在一个单元格内换行显示的多行日志被拆分成多个记录。通过重新导入并正确设置文本识别符为双引号,解决了此问题。打印与预览差异 页面布局中的缩放设置可能导致换行显示异常。当设置"适应页面宽度"时,系统为保持整体布局可能压缩行高,使本应换行的文本显示为截断状态。这种显示与实际的差异常导致打印输出不符合预期。 某教师制作成绩分析表时,在正常视图下换行显示完美,但打印预览时文本全部挤在一起。最终发现是因为在页面设置中选择了"将工作表调整为一页",取消该选项后打印效果与屏幕显示保持一致。跨平台兼容性问题 不同操作系统使用的换行符标准不同:Windows采用CRLF( carriage return+line feed,回车+换行),类Unix系统使用LF(line feed,换行),MacOS传统使用CR(carriage return,回车)。当文件跨平台传输时,换行符解析差异会导致显示异常。 某跨国团队协作时,在Linux系统生成的CSV文件在Windows电子表格中打开后,所有换行处都显示为特殊符号。使用Notepad++的"转换换行符"功能将文件格式统一为DOS/Windows格式后问题解决。单元格合并引发的限制 合并单元格后,系统只保留原左上角单元格的格式和内容。若被合并的单元格包含换行符,这些换行信息会在合并过程中丢失。此外合并单元格的自动换行功能存在更多限制,通常需要手动调整行高才能正确显示。 某人事专员制作岗位说明表时,先在各单元格输入带换行的文本后再合并单元格,导致所有换行消失。改为先合并单元格再输入文本并配合Alt+Enter添加换行后,才实现预期效果。测试表明,合并单元格内的最大换行次数比普通单元格少50%。宏与脚本执行的影响 通过Visual Basic for Applications(VBA)编写的宏在处理文本时,若未显式处理换行符(如使用vbCrLf常数),可能会在字符串操作过程中丢失换行格式。特别是使用Replace或Trim函数时,容易意外移除控制字符。 某开发人员编写数据清洗宏时,使用Trim函数清理空格后,所有换行符同时被移除。改为使用自定义函数仅去除首尾空格而非所有空白字符后,成功保留文本中的换行格式。专业测试显示,标准Trim函数会移除ASCII码小于32的所有控制字符。共享协作时的权限限制 当电子表格存储在SharePoint或OneDrive等共享平台并启用协同编辑时,某些权限设置可能限制格式修改。用户虽然能看到换行效果,但因写入权限不足无法实际修改换行设置,这种权限冲突常被误认为换行功能失效。 某项目组共享需求文档时,部分成员无法修改其他人员添加的换行格式。通过文档所有者调整共享权限为"可编辑"而非"可查看注释",解决了此问题。平台限制显示,注释权限用户最多只能添加文本内容,不能修改现有格式设置。 通过以上分析可见,电子表格中文本换行问题是个多因素耦合的技术现象。掌握单元格格式、特殊字符处理、数据导入导出设置等关键环节,结合实际情况选择恰当的解决方案,才能确保文本显示符合预期。建议用户在处理重要数据前,先在小范围测试换行效果,避免大规模操作后的返工风险。
相关文章
在电子表格软件中激活图表看似简单,却蕴含着影响数据处理效率的关键细节。本文系统梳理了通过键盘激活图表的多种方法,涵盖基础选择、组合键应用、功能键操作等场景,并结合财务分析和销售报表等实际案例,深入解析不同操作对后续编辑流程的影响。无论初学者还是资深用户,都能掌握精准控制图表元素的专业技巧。
2025-11-30 19:12:34
135人看过
当您满心期待地打开下载的文档,却发现满屏乱码时,这种体验无疑令人沮丧。乱码问题的根源错综复杂,可能源于文件编码设置冲突、字体兼容性不足、传输过程中数据损坏,或是软件版本之间存在差异。本文将系统性地剖析十二个导致乱码的核心原因,并针对每种情况提供经过验证的解决方案,例如如何调整编码设置、修复受损文件以及统一文档格式标准,旨在帮助您从根本上理解和解决这一常见难题。
2025-11-30 19:11:44
208人看过
微软办公软件中的文档处理工具提供了多层次的安全保护方案,涵盖格式限制、编辑权限控制、内容加密等核心功能。本文将系统解析十二项关键保护设置,包括强制只读模式、区域编辑授权、文档密码加密等技术细节,并结合实际办公场景案例说明如何灵活运用这些功能确保文档安全性与协作效率的平衡。
2025-11-30 19:11:06
51人看过
本文深入解析电子表格软件中斜率计算功能的数学原理与应用方法,重点阐述最小二乘法在趋势线分析中的实现机制,通过实际案例演示斜率函数在销售预测和实验数据分析中的专业应用场景。
2025-11-30 18:52:46
216人看过
在文档处理过程中,许多用户会遇到自动生成的目录无法点击跳转的情况。这一问题通常源于样式应用不规范、标题层级缺失或文档格式兼容性差异。通过系统分析十二个关键环节,本文将深入解析目录失效的技术原理,并提供从基础设置到高级修复的完整解决方案,帮助读者彻底掌握目录链接的生成机制。
2025-11-30 18:51:05
166人看过
本文详细解析电子表格中映射的概念与实现方式,涵盖基础函数匹配到高级动态数组的12种核心应用场景。通过18个实操案例演示如何利用索引匹配、跨表引用及条件映射等技术解决实际数据处理问题,帮助用户全面提升数据关联与分析效率。
2025-11-30 18:42:42
152人看过
热门推荐
资讯中心:
.webp)
.webp)
.webp)

.webp)
